Manager Woodyard Operations

The opportunity:

The Manager Woodyard Operations reports to the Manager Pulp Mill and supervises the Woodyard Area Day Supervisor/OMC.  This position is responsible and accountable for all Woodyard day to day operations, personnel, safety, environmental impact, cost center, and quality and production requirements which is coordinated through the shift Team leaders.   Managing daily production resources, interfacing with other departments, and troubleshooting any operational and/or quality issues is the primary focus of this role.  The overall objective and responsibility are to ensure the personnel have the tools and information needed to perform their jobs safely and effectively.

 

 

How you will impact WestRock:

In this role, you’ll be entrusted with the stewardship of assets and be expected to make timely operational decisions to maximize mill production with respect to mill issues. As a key leader in the department, you will drive shift performance to meet departmental objectives with a key focus on continuous improvement.Drive safety engagement, awareness, and adherence to safety policies and proceduresActively apply and ensure alignment with the quality policies and principles.Manage all aspects of costs related to the woodyard area and work to maximize and improve costs, yields, and waste.Ensure environmental policies and practices are adhered to.Drive team effectiveness through continued employee development and performance management Responsible for conducting business with integrity and respect, being accountable, and actively pursuing excellence to help achieve WestRock’s Path To One goals.


 What you need to succeed:

Bachelor’s degree in engineering or related technical discipline or a minimum of 10 years supervisory experience in a pulping or papermaking position.Experience in Woodyard operations, chip handling, and system operations is preferred.General understanding of a paper mill operations and interdependencyAbility to lead and motivate others in the areas of safety and production.Ability to communicate clearly and effectively with all levels of the organization.Ability to clearly define objectives and be effective in involving others in achievement of these objectives.Dedicated to continuous improvement in the Woodyard department with special emphasis on safety, quality, environment, production, and cost.Call duty required.Aligned with our company values of Integrity, Respect, Accountability, and Excellence
